ASoC: omap-pcm: Allow only formats with 1, 2, and 4 byte physical size

sDMA support only transfer elements with 1, 2, and 4 byte physical
size. Initialize the pcm driver accordingly.

/* sDMA supports only 1, 2, and 4 byte transfer elements. */
static void omap_pcm_limit_supported_formats(void)
{
int i;
for (i = 0; i < SNDRV_PCM_FORMAT_LAST; i++) {
switch (snd_pcm_format_physical_width(i)) {
case 8:
case 16:
case 32:
omap_pcm_hardware.formats |= (1LL << i);
break;
default:
break;
}
}
}
